For persons with HIV or AIDS who also fight with addiction, their pre-existing continuing medical condition is something that will need to be recognized and addressed simultaneously while they receive rehabilitation for their addiction. Keeping this client in rehab is not only imperative for their safety, but for the safety of the public due to the fact they are likely to transmit their disease to others in the case their substance abuse issue continue or worsen.
In many cases, clients who struggle with both HIV/AIDS and addiction at the same time may have let their bodies fall apart because of the lack of care most people with addictions show themselves even when they are without HIV or AIDS. Many stop taking their medicine, stop seeking medical care, etc. and may need critical medical help once they do reach addiction rehabilitation. Aside from treatment for their drug or alcohol problem, in a rehabilitation facility that provides treatment for people with HIV or AIDS, clients will receive a medical assessment to see if they have any other problems associated with their disease. This would include screening for tuberculosis, Hepatitis A, B, and C, other sexually transmitted diseases, dental issues, diabetes and mental health problems.
Substance abuse rehab for persons with HIV/AIDS in Randolph would include detoxification services which are safely handled with both the patient and the treatment staff in mind. Through holistic services, psychotherapy and counseling persons with HIV or AIDS can become motivated to be sober and healthier, and attending self-help groups where other people have the same goal is encouraged.
